About Holly

Music student at Murray Edwards College, Cambridge and soprano in the Choir of Clare College.
singer (Soprano)
Cambridge/Manchester

Holly started out singing with the Hallé Youth Choir in 2011 under Richard Wilberforce. With them she performed at The Bridgewater Hall including performances of Verdi's Simon Boccenegra, Wagner's Die Meistersingers and Stravinsky's Symphony of Psalms. Further to this Holly was part of the semi-chorus for the Hallé's Gramaphone Award winning CD, Elgar's The Apostles. She performed in The First Night of the Proms in 2013 in Vaughan Williams's A Sea Symphony, where she also sung with the semi-chorus. This was one of four BBC Proms performances between 2012 and 2015 with the Hallé. In 2013 Holly joined the National Youth Training Choir under Greg Beardsell. In 2014 she became a soprano in the Choir of Clare College, reading music at Murray Edwards College, Cambridge and has recently graduated. During her first year they performed at King's Place, London in Mozart's Requiem with the Aurora Orchestra and sung in the Library of Congress. She has now sung on six CD recordings with the choir. She has also sung with The Exon Singers (2015) which included a BBC Radio 3 evensong broadcast from Buckfast Abbey. She studies with Nicola-Jane Kemp and Margaret McDonald. Holly began her orchestral playing with the Hallé Youth Orchestra in 2011 under Andrew Gourlay and later, Jamie Phillips. With them she performed across the country and abroad, highlights including playing at The Sage, regular performances at The Bridgewater Hall and playing in a world premiere chamber opera, Hot House at The Royal Opera House.
